.gitignore只能忽略那些原来没有被track的文件,如果某些文件已经被纳入了版本管理中,则修改.gitignore是无效的。那么解决方法就是先把本地缓存删除(改变成未track状态),然后再提交:

git rm -r --cached .
git add .
git commit -m 'update .gitignore file'

最新文章

  1. IE6 跟随滚动解决方法
  2. cocos2d学习笔记
  3. ASP.NET MVC 5 默认模板的JS和CSS 是怎么加载的?
  4. 一个SharePoint定时器 (SPJobDefinition)
  5. WinForm 快捷键设置
  6. JAX-WS
  7. 50道经典的JAVA编程题 (1-5)
  8. HDOJ 1285 确定比赛名次(拓扑排序)
  9. windows下开发PHP扩展(无需Cygwin)
  10. ESLint 规则详解(一)
  11. Logger之Logger.getLogger(CLass)技巧代替system.out.print
  12. Python3浮点型(float)运算结果不正确处理办法
  13. 移动端单位rem计算
  14. 使用ajax请求后端程序时,关于目标程序路径问题
  15. vue 全局变量
  16. DevExpress GridView 整理(转)
  17. hbase与sqoop的集成
  18. Lua和C++交互 学习记录之三:全局值交互
  19. 【转】Java中static关键字用法总结
  20. MySql绿色版安装步骤和方法,以及配置文件修改,Mysql服务器启动

热门文章

  1. APACHE LOG4J™ 2
  2. 随便浏览感觉简单易用的Orm
  3. mongoose修改数组中某个特定的值
  4. GlobalConfig
  5. 阿里云流计算BLINK
  6. (原创)C++11改进我们的程序之简化我们的程序(二)
  7. Android使用binder访问service的方式(一)
  8. 交叉编译环境以及开发板上-/bin/sh: ./hello: not found 转载自 http://blankboy.72pines.com
  9. 【Linux技术】linux之configure,pkg-config和PKG_CONFIG_PATH
  10. PostgreSQL建表SQL语句写法